Todd Farmer
Partner
Professional Experience
Todd Farmer concentrates his practice in business bankruptcy, personal bankruptcy, personal injury and tax resolution. He holds a bachelor’s degree in accounting from the University of Kentucky and received his law degree from the University of Kentucky College of Law. Prior to founding Farmer and Wright, Todd was a partner with the law firm of Stout Farmer & King for ten years. Todd holds a Certified Public Accountant’s license and worked for Arthur Andersen in Cincinnati, Ohio and Deloitte & Touche in Lexington, Kentucky. Todd provided consulting services in business modeling, mergers and acquisitions, estate planning and tax controversies. Todd has also served as the president of a restaurant development company of a large franchise chain. Todd is a member of the Kentucky Bar Association, the National Association of Consumer Bankruptcy Attorneys and the American Bankruptcy Institute.
